Modification of a Commercially Available Viscometer for Photometric Determination of Erythrocyte Aggregation Potential.

Abstract

A standard Wells-Brookfield plate-cone microviscometer was modified so that the sample chamber could be transilluminated under shear. The transmitted light was monitored by two photosensitive transistors 180 degrees apart. The output was electronically summed and displayed on a strip chart recorder and digital voltmeter. The resulting records were quite free of oscillations. Absolute values for different shear rates could not be obtained but relative changes were reliably reproduced. Results compared favorably with those of previous investigators and interpretation of these results was considered to be as they described. The finished device is currently being used in this laboratory for studying changes in erythrocyte aggregation potential in various pathologic states. (Author)
